Metropolitan Education District Foundation




The MetroED Foundation began as the Central Santa Clara Regional Occupational Agency Foundation in 1992 to operate for the advancement of education and solicit contributions and raise funds for the support of educational projects for the Central Santa Clara County Regional Occupational Agency. In 1997, the articles of incorporation were amended to change the name to the Metropolitan Education District Foundation.

The MetroED Foundation, a 501(c)(3) non-profit corporation, works to support on-campus high school student programs for the Central County Occupational Center (CCOC) and student programs for the Metropolitan Adult Education Program (MAEP).

The Foundation oversees the Leroy R. Morrell fund, a $1.2 million trust left to the students enrolled in either the CCOC Electrical Maintenance or Heating and Air Conditioning programs. Mr. Morrell was an alumnus of San Jose Tech High and was passionate about assisting students in these programs.
